Common Types of Siding Materials

There are various types of siding materials available today, each with its own set of advantages and disadvantages. Understanding these options is vital for homeowners, builders, and architects when making informed decisions. Below are some of the most common siding materials, along with their characteristics:

  • Vinyl Siding: Known for its affordability and low maintenance, vinyl siding is popular among homeowners. It is resistant to moisture and does not require painting, but it may fade over time and can be less durable in extreme weather.
  • Wood Siding: Wood siding offers a classic and natural appearance. It can be stained or painted to achieve the desired look; however, it requires regular maintenance to prevent rot and insect damage.
  • Fiber Cement Siding: This material combines wood fibers and cement, providing durability and resistance to pests and fire. Fiber cement can mimic the look of wood or stucco, making it a versatile option.
  • Metal Siding: Typically made from aluminum or steel, metal siding is highly durable and resistant to the elements. It requires minimal maintenance, but it can be prone to dents and scratches.
  • Stucco: Often used in warmer climates, stucco is a cement-based siding that provides a unique texture. It is energy-efficient and fire-resistant, yet it may crack if not properly installed or maintained.

Each siding material presents unique benefits and challenges, making it essential for those involved in building design to carefully consider their options based on climate, budget, and aesthetic preferences.

Wood Siding

Wood siding is a timeless choice that offers both aesthetic appeal and functional benefits. Its natural beauty can enhance the charm of any home, providing a warm and inviting look that many homeowners desire. Additionally, wood siding boasts excellent insulation properties, helping to maintain comfortable interior temperatures and potentially reducing energy costs.However, while wood siding presents numerous advantages, it is also essential to consider its drawbacks.

One of the most significant challenges associated with wood siding is the need for regular maintenance, including painting or staining to protect against weathering. Furthermore, wood is susceptible to pests, such as termites and woodpeckers, which can compromise its integrity over time.

Pros and Cons of Wood Siding

The following points Artikel the benefits and challenges of using wood siding for your home:

  • Natural Beauty: Wood siding provides a unique, organic appearance that can be customized with various stains or paints to suit personal preferences.
  • Insulation Properties: Wood is an excellent insulator, helping to keep homes warmer in winter and cooler in summer.
  • Eco-Friendly: Wood is a renewable resource, making it a sustainable choice when sourced responsibly.
  • Versatility: Available in various styles and finishes, wood siding can complement different architectural designs.

Despite its benefits, wood siding has some notable disadvantages:

  • Maintenance Requirements: Wood siding requires regular upkeep, including repainting or staining to prevent deterioration.
  • Vulnerability to Pests: Wood can attract insects such as termites, making it susceptible to damage over time.
  • Cost: Although the initial investment may be lower than some materials, long-term maintenance costs can add up.
  • Weather Sensitivity: Wood siding may warp or expand with moisture exposure, leading to potential installation issues.

Comparison of Wood Species for Siding

Different wood species offer varying levels of durability and cost, which can impact your decision-making process when selecting wood siding. Below is a comparison table highlighting some popular wood species used for siding, along with their respective durability and cost:

Wood Species Durability (Years) Cost per Square Foot
Cedar 20-30 $3.50 – $8.00
Redwood 25-50 $4.00 – $9.00
Pine 10-20 $1.50 – $5.00
Spruce 10-20 $1.75 – $4.75
Fir 15-25 $2.00 – $6.00

Vinyl Siding

Vinyl siding has become one of the most popular choices for homeowners seeking a practical and cost-effective exterior cladding option. This material offers a unique blend of aesthetics and functionality, making it an appealing alternative to traditional siding materials.The advantages of vinyl siding are numerous, particularly when it comes to affordability and maintenance. Vinyl siding is typically less expensive than wood or fiber cement options, making it an attractive choice for budget-conscious homeowners.

Additionally, it requires minimal upkeep; unlike wood, it does not need to be painted or stained regularly. Cleaning vinyl siding generally involves just a simple wash with soap and water, allowing homeowners to save both time and money over the years.

Popular Vinyl Siding Styles and Their Features

Vinyl siding comes in a variety of styles, each with unique features that can enhance the aesthetic appeal of a home. The following list highlights some popular styles:

  • Traditional Lap Siding: This style features long horizontal panels that create a classic look, often mimicking the appearance of wood siding.
  • Vertical Siding: Ideal for creating a more modern look, vertical siding can make a home appear taller and is often used in contemporary designs.
  • Shake and Shingle Siding: These styles offer a textured appearance that resembles wood shakes or shingles, perfect for achieving a rustic charm.
  • Board and Batten: Featuring wide boards with narrow battens covering the seams, this style is often associated with traditional barns and offers a striking visual impact.
  • Insulated Vinyl Siding: This variant includes a layer of insulation, providing better energy efficiency and reducing noise, making it an excellent option for energy-conscious homeowners.

Fiber Cement Siding

Fiber cement siding has gained popularity among homeowners and builders due to its unique blend of durability, aesthetic appeal, and low maintenance. Composed of a mixture of cement, sand, and cellulose fibers, this siding material offers a formidable alternative to traditional materials. Its robust properties make it particularly well-suited for various climates, providing an excellent balance between performance and design.Fiber cement siding boasts several significant benefits, making it an appealing choice for both new constructions and renovations.

One of its primary advantages is its fire resistance; this material is non-combustible, which can enhance the safety of a home and may even qualify property owners for lower insurance rates. Additionally, fiber cement siding has a long lifespan, often exceeding 30 years with minimal maintenance, which can provide cost savings in the long run. It also withstands harsh weather conditions, including heavy winds, rain, and even hail, making it a resilient choice for any region.

Advantages and Drawbacks of Fiber Cement Siding

While fiber cement siding presents numerous benefits, it is essential to consider its drawbacks as well. The weight of fiber cement can be a significant factor in its installation process. Being substantially heavier than vinyl or wood siding, it often requires additional structural support, which can complicate installation. Furthermore, the installation costs tend to be higher due to the need for specialized labor and tools, which may not make it the most budget-friendly option initially.To provide a clearer perspective on the maintenance requirements of fiber cement siding compared to other common materials, the following table Artikels essential maintenance tasks and their frequency:

Siding Material Maintenance Task Frequency
Fiber Cement Power wash to remove dirt and mold Every 1-2 years
Wood Siding Repaint or stain Every 3-7 years
Vinyl Siding Wash to remove dirt Every 1-2 years

In summary, while fiber cement siding offers exceptional durability and fire resistance, it does come with considerations regarding weight and installation costs. Homeowners must weigh these factors against their specific needs and preferences when choosing the best siding material for their homes.

Brick and Stone Siding

Brick and stone siding is celebrated for its timeless beauty and exceptional durability, making it a popular choice for homeowners seeking a robust exterior cladding solution. These materials not only enhance the aesthetic appeal of a property but also offer significant practical advantages that contribute to long-term cost savings and energy efficiency.Brick and stone siding provides a myriad of benefits, particularly in terms of longevity and thermal performance.

The durability of these materials is unparalleled, often lasting for decades with minimal maintenance. They resist various environmental factors, including fire, pests, and severe weather conditions, which adds to their appeal. Additionally, brick and stone have excellent energy efficiency properties due to their ability to retain heat during colder months and stay cool when temperatures rise. This can lead to reduced energy costs, making them an environmentally friendly choice as well.

Pros and Cons of Brick and Stone Siding

When considering brick and stone siding, it is important to weigh both the advantages and the disadvantages. Pros:

  • Durability: Brick and stone are highly resistant to wear and tear, ensuring longevity and minimal maintenance.
  • Energy Efficiency: Their thermal mass helps regulate indoor temperatures, reducing heating and cooling costs.
  • Fire Resistance: Both materials are non-combustible, providing enhanced safety against fire hazards.
  • Aesthetic Appeal: They offer a classic and elegant look that can elevate the overall curb appeal of a home.
  • Low Environmental Impact: Brick and stone are sourced from natural materials and can often be recycled, making them eco-friendly options.

Cons:

  • High Initial Costs: The upfront cost of brick and stone siding is significantly higher compared to other materials.
  • Installation Complexity: Installing these materials requires skilled labor and can take more time than other siding options, contributing to higher installation costs.
  • Limited Insulation Value: While they are energy-efficient, brick and stone may still require additional insulation in certain climates.
  • Weight: The substantial weight of these materials necessitates a strong foundational support, which could increase construction costs.

Environmental Impact Comparison

Understanding the environmental implications of different siding materials can guide homeowners in making sustainability-oriented choices. Below is a comparison of brick and stone siding relative to other common siding materials, emphasizing their environmental impact.

Material Recyclability Energy Efficiency Source Sustainability
Brick High Moderate to High Natural Clay
Stone High High Natural Stone
Vinyl Low Moderate Petrochemical Products
Wood Moderate Moderate Renewable Resource

Brick and stone are often lauded for their high recyclability and energy-efficient properties, making them exemplary choices for environmentally conscious homeowners.

Metal Siding

Metal siding has become an increasingly popular choice in modern architecture due to its unique blend of aesthetic appeal, durability, and versatility. This type of siding is available in various materials, including aluminum and steel, and is known for its ability to withstand harsh weather conditions while requiring minimal maintenance. Metal siding offers several advantages, particularly its durability and resistance to weather elements.

It is an excellent barrier against wind, rain, and extreme temperatures, making it a reliable option for homeowners seeking long-lasting exterior solutions. However, there are also some drawbacks, such as potential noise issues during rain or hail and its high thermal conductivity, which can lead to increased energy costs if not properly insulated.

Types of Metal Siding and Their Applications

When considering metal siding for a building project, it is important to recognize the various options available and their applications in contemporary design. Below is a list of common types of metal siding along with their specific uses:

  • Aluminum Siding: Known for its lightweight nature and resistance to corrosion, aluminum siding is ideal for coastal areas where saltwater can accelerate wear. It is often used in residential and commercial buildings for its sleek appearance and color variety.
  • Steel Siding: Steel siding is incredibly durable and is often used in industrial or agricultural settings. Its strength makes it resistant to denting and damage, while the option of galvanized coatings helps prevent rust.
  • Corten Steel Siding: This type of steel is designed to rust over time, creating a unique, weathered aesthetic that appeals to modern architecture. Corten steel is commonly used in artistic installations or as an accent feature on buildings.
  • Metal Composite Panels: Comprised of two thin layers of metal enclosing a core material, these panels are often used for contemporary commercial architecture. They provide an excellent balance of durability and design flexibility.
  • Vinyl-Coated Steel: This option combines the strength of steel with a vinyl coating that adds color and aesthetic appeal. It is ideal for residential applications where homeowners desire the look of wood without the maintenance.

Composite Siding

Composite siding combines materials to offer a product that captures the aesthetic appeal of natural wood while providing enhanced durability and versatility. This type of siding has become increasingly popular among homeowners seeking an attractive yet practical solution for their exteriors. Composite siding comes in various styles, colors, and textures, allowing for a high degree of customization to match any architectural design.

Its ability to mimic the look of wood without the associated maintenance makes it an appealing choice for many. However, there are important considerations to weigh when contemplating the use of composite siding, including its potential fading and initial investment cost.

Benefits and Downsides of Composite Siding, Siding materials pros and cons

Understanding both the advantages and disadvantages of composite siding is crucial for making an informed decision. Below are key points that highlight its benefits and drawbacks.

  • Versatility: Composite siding can be designed to resemble a range of materials, including wood, which allows for a tailored aesthetic without sacrificing performance.
  • Aesthetic Appeal: Available in various colors and finishes, composite siding provides an attractive façade that enhances the overall curb appeal of a home.
  • Durability: This siding type is often resistant to rot, insects, and harsh weather conditions, which can extend its lifespan compared to traditional wood siding.
  • Low Maintenance: Unlike wood siding, composite siding does not require regular painting or staining, leading to lower long-term maintenance costs.
  • Cost: The initial cost of composite siding can be higher than some other materials, which may deter some homeowners.
  • Fading: Over time, composite siding may experience color fading due to prolonged exposure to sunlight, impacting its visual appeal.

Comparison Table: Composite Siding vs. Natural Wood Siding

The following table provides a side-by-side comparison of composite siding and natural wood siding, particularly focusing on maintenance requirements and lifespan, which are vital factors when making a siding choice.

Feature Composite Siding Natural Wood Siding
Maintenance Minimal; typically requires only occasional cleaning High; requires regular painting/staining and inspections for rot
Lifespan 20-30 years depending on quality and care 10-20 years; can be less in harsh environments

Evaluating Long-Term Costs vs. Benefits

Understanding the balance between upfront costs and long-term benefits is key to making an informed siding choice. Here are several important factors to consider when evaluating siding materials:

  • Durability: Consider the lifespan of each material. For example, fiber cement siding typically lasts 25 to 50 years, while wood siding may require more frequent replacement or maintenance.
  • Maintenance Requirements: Different materials demand varying levels of upkeep. Vinyl siding is generally low-maintenance, while wood siding may necessitate regular painting or sealing.
  • Energy Efficiency: Insulated siding options can contribute to lower heating and cooling costs, which can offset their initial expense over time.
  • Resale Value: Certain siding materials, such as fiber cement and stone, are known to offer a high return on investment, enhancing the property’s market value.
  • Local Climate Considerations: Materials suited for specific climates can prevent costly damages. For instance, brick and stone perform well in areas prone to extreme weather, while vinyl may warp in high heat.

Taking these factors into account will help homeowners not only appreciate the immediate costs associated with each siding type but also recognize the potential for long-term savings and increased home value. Common Queries

What is the most durable siding material?

Brick and stone are often considered the most durable siding materials, offering long-lasting performance with minimal maintenance.

How often should siding be replaced?

The lifespan of siding materials varies, but most should be replaced every 20 to 50 years, depending on the type and maintenance.

Can siding improve energy efficiency?

Yes, proper siding can significantly enhance a home’s energy efficiency by providing better insulation and reducing heating and cooling costs.

What is the best siding material for coastal areas?

Fiber cement and metal siding are preferable for coastal areas due to their resistance to moisture and harsh weather conditions.

Are there eco-friendly siding options available?

Yes, options like reclaimed wood, fiber cement, and certain vinyl products can be environmentally friendly, depending on their sourcing and manufacturing processes.
